Thule, hands down. That is why it costs more. Welded aluminum versus steel, and the most important thing to me, weight capacity. Yakima uses same load bars that they use on rooftops and for those who don't know this, there is no roof in the US that has a higher capacity than 165lbs! Insurance reasons, not Yakima or Thule. So, that being said, the Outdoorsman is using those bars which if you ever see a ww kayaker using this system, you will notice the huge bend in the bars. Thule's Xsporter can handle 450lbs! Big difference and no rusting.
